【发布时间】:2012-09-16 06:33:32
【问题描述】:
我正在 Python 中创建一个脚本以将 Pidgin 与 Unity (Ubuntu 12.04) 集成,我已经设法使用 Unity API 进行计数通知系统,但我不知道对话窗口时激活了什么事件或信号获得焦点(清除消息计数器)... 我已经尝试了 Pidgin 文档(https://developer.pidgin.im/wiki/DbusHowto)上可用的一些信号,但它们都不起作用,窗口时是否触发了任何 GTK(或任何)事件聊天获得焦点?
【问题讨论】:
-
所有 Pidgin 的 DBus 信号都可以在here 找到。看起来没有该事件的信号。
-
我尝试使用其中的一些,但它们最终会覆盖用于更新计数器的信号“received-im-msg”......所以当我添加时,它们最终会擦除计数器瞬间
标签: python plugins ubuntu-12.04 dbus pidgin